    For the Al-Salam Chihara polynomials defined by \[ (1- q^{n+1})Q_{n+1}(x)= (x-aq^ n)Q_ n(x)- (c-bq^{n-1})Q_{n-1}(x), \quad n\geq 0;\tag{1} \] \[ Q-1(x)=0, \qquad Q_ 0=1 \tag{2} \] the Hamburger moment problem associated with \(Q_ n(x)\) for \(| q|>1\) and \(a^ 2<4b\), as pointed out in [Mem. Am. Math. Soc. 319, 55 p. (1985; Zbl 0572.33012)] is indeterminate. That is, there are infinitely many measures \(\{d\psi\}\) with respect to which \(Q_ n\)'s are orthogonal. Among these measures there is a one parameter family of measures \(\{d\psi(t,\sigma)\}\), the ``external measures'' which are parameterized by a real parameter \(\sigma\), allowed to take value \(\pm\infty\), such that \[ {{A(Z)- \sigma C(Z)} \over {B(Z)-\sigma D(Z)}}= \int_{- \infty}^ \infty {{d\psi(t,\sigma)} \over {z-t}} \] where \(A(Z)\), \(B(Z)\), \((Z)\) and \(D(Z)\) are certain entire functions. The authors find the generating functions for the polynomials of (1.1) and (1.2) and for their numerator polynomials where \(| q|>1\) and \(a^ 2\leq 4b\); they also determine the asymptotic behaviour of the numerator and denominator polynomials when \(a^ 2<4b\) and apply these results to explicitly compute the entire functions \(A(Z)\), \(B(Z)\), \(C(Z)\) and \(D(Z)\) for \(a^ 2<4b\). The Stieltjes transform of the external measure \(\{d\psi(t,\sigma)\}\) is identified and then used to characterize the support of \(d\psi(t,\sigma)\) for \(-\infty\leq\sigma\leq\infty\).
